A premium cabin seat designed for business travelers offers a dedicated workspace with features like a large tray table, power outlets, enhanced privacy, and ergonomic design. These accommodations facilitate productivity and comfort, allowing passengers to conduct business, attend virtual meetings, or work on projects during air travel. An example includes lie-flat seats that transform into a bed, accompanied by an adjustable work surface and ample legroom.

Such dedicated workspaces in the air contribute significantly to business efficiency. They enable uninterrupted work flow, crucial for executives managing demanding schedules. Historically, air travel often represented lost productivity time. The evolution of these specialized seating arrangements reflects the increasing demand for in-flight connectivity and workspace solutions, acknowledging the value of time for business professionals. This reflects a shift toward maximizing travel time, converting it from downtime to productive hours.

1. Ergonomic Design

Ergonomic design plays a crucial role in the effectiveness of an executive flight seat configured for productivity. It directly impacts passenger well-being and work efficiency during extended flights. By prioritizing comfort and support, ergonomic principles facilitate sustained focus and minimize physical strain associated with prolonged seated postures.

  • Lumbar Support

    Proper lumbar support is essential for maintaining healthy spinal alignment and preventing back pain. Adjustable lumbar mechanisms in executive flight seats allow individual customization, accommodating varying body types and postural preferences. This adaptability is crucial for long-haul flights, where sustained poor posture can lead to discomfort and reduced productivity.

  • Seat Cushion and Backrest Angle

    Optimal seat cushion density and adjustable backrest angles contribute to postural stability and comfort. Contoured cushions distribute weight evenly, minimizing pressure points. Adjustable backrests allow passengers to find a comfortable working angle, reducing strain on the neck and back. These features are vital for maintaining focus during extended work sessions.

  • Adjustable Headrest

    Adjustable headrests provide crucial neck support, especially during sleep or periods of relaxation. Proper head and neck alignment reduces muscle strain and promotes restful breaks, enabling passengers to return to work refreshed and focused. This feature is particularly important for overnight flights or flights across multiple time zones.

  • Legroom and Footrest

    Adequate legroom and adjustable footrests are essential for promoting good circulation and preventing leg fatigue. Sufficient space allows for comfortable leg extension, while footrests provide support and minimize pressure points. These features are especially beneficial for taller individuals or those prone to circulation issues during long flights.

By integrating these ergonomic elements, executive flight seats effectively support sustained work and comfort during air travel. This thoughtful design contributes directly to passenger well-being and maximizes in-flight productivity, demonstrating a clear understanding of the demands of modern business travel.

7. Adaptive Lighting

Adaptive lighting plays a crucial role in enhancing the functionality and comfort of an executive flight seat designed for productivity. Proper lighting conditions significantly impact work efficiency, reduce eye strain, and contribute to overall passenger well-being during long flights. Effective lighting design considers the unique challenges of the in-flight environment, including varying ambient light levels and the need for individual control.

  • Adjustable Intensity and Color Temperature

    Adjustable intensity and color temperature settings allow passengers to customize their lighting environment to suit individual preferences and task requirements. Brighter, cooler light promotes alertness and focus during work sessions, while warmer, dimmer light facilitates relaxation and rest. For example, a passenger working on a spreadsheet might prefer bright, cool light, while someone watching a movie might opt for a warmer, dimmer setting. This adaptability contributes significantly to passenger comfort and productivity.

  • Targeted Task Lighting

    Directional task lighting provides focused illumination for specific work areas, minimizing glare and enhancing visibility. Adjustable gooseneck lamps or integrated reading lights allow passengers to direct light precisely where it’s needed, reducing eye strain and improving work efficiency. For instance, a lawyer reviewing a contract benefits from targeted task lighting to illuminate the document without disturbing other passengers. This focused illumination enhances productivity and minimizes distractions.

  • Ambient Lighting Integration

    Integration with the cabin’s ambient lighting system allows for smooth transitions between work and rest modes. As the cabin lighting dims for sleep, the personal workspace lighting can be adjusted accordingly to minimize disruption and promote relaxation. Conversely, during work periods, the individual lighting can be brightened independently of the cabin lighting. This seamless integration enhances passenger comfort and facilitates adaptation to varying in-flight conditions.

  • Minimizing Glare and Reflections

    Careful consideration of light placement and fixture design minimizes glare and reflections on laptop screens and other work surfaces. Indirect lighting and strategically positioned fixtures reduce distracting reflections, improving visibility and reducing eye strain. This is particularly crucial for tasks requiring prolonged screen use, such as data analysis or software development. A glare-free environment promotes sustained focus and minimizes fatigue.

Optimizing Productivity in Executive Flight Seats

The following tips provide practical guidance for maximizing productivity within the specialized workspace of an executive flight seat. Strategic preparation and effective utilization of available features contribute significantly to a productive and comfortable in-flight work experience.

Tip 1: Pre-Flight Planning is Essential: Organize digital and physical materials before boarding. Download necessary documents, presentations, and resources to minimize reliance on in-flight connectivity. A well-organized workspace promotes efficient workflow.

Tip 2: Utilize In-Seat Technology Effectively: Familiarize oneself with the seat’s features, including power outlets, adjustable lighting, and entertainment system controls, before departure. Understanding available technology maximizes productivity and comfort.

Tip 3: Prioritize Tasks Strategically: Allocate in-flight time to tasks that benefit from uninterrupted focus, such as drafting documents, reviewing reports, or developing presentations. Prioritization maximizes the value of dedicated work time.

Tip 4: Noise Management is Key: Noise-canceling headphones or earplugs minimize distractions and promote concentration. A quiet environment fosters deep work and enhances productivity.

Tip 5: Maintain Digital Security: Utilize a Virtual Private Network (VPN) to secure online activity and protect sensitive data when using in-flight Wi-Fi. Robust security measures protect confidential information.

Tip 6: Optimize Ergonomics: Adjust the seat, headrest, and lumbar support to maintain proper posture and minimize physical strain. Ergonomic considerations contribute to sustained comfort and focus.

Tip 7: Stay Hydrated and Minimize Caffeine: Hydration and mindful consumption of caffeine promote alertness and well-being during long flights. Proper hydration supports cognitive function and sustained energy levels.

Tip 8: Respect Fellow Passengers: Maintain a professional demeanor and respect the privacy of those nearby. Considerate conduct contributes to a positive and productive cabin environment for all.

By implementing these strategies, travelers can effectively leverage the capabilities of an executive flight seat to create a productive and comfortable in-flight workspace. Preparation, effective technology utilization, and mindful work habits contribute significantly to maximizing productivity during air travel.
